Instead of the applique, I spend the day on the sewing machine.  I got all of the pieces paired up and sewn into group with top pieces attached to bottom pieces.  Everything here lined up nicely ironed waiting for the next step.


After lunch I started sewing all the sections together.  This part took me a fair amount of time to do.  I ironed them all open.  At this point ALL the small sub blocks are done.  Here they are all lined up.  I am so glad that I got this much done.  This quilt was started back in August/2014, for my eldest niece.  But with one thing to another it kept getting delayed.  I am so happy to start seeing some progress on this quilt.


After dinner I wanted to do some more, but by this time my eyes are tied and it becomes difficult to do any sewing.  So, I contented myself with sorting out the sub blocks into the finished blocks.  My goal here is to sort out the colours enough that like fabrics are not touching like fabrics in the finished product.  

Sounds easy enough, but you would be surprised how much shifting of blocks is done at this stage, while making sure you still have the blocks in the right orientation to be sewn.  Good thing I had a lot of variety within each colour.
